Terence Atmane Reflects on His Upset Victory and Future Prospects

Sport news

In a post-match interview with Tennis Majors, French tennis player Terence Atmane shared his insights following an impressive victory over Top 10 player Félix Auger-Aliassime.

“Fantastic,” Atmane exclaimed, describing his performance. He revealed that despite some initial nervousness at the start of the match, he successfully managed to overcome it. A pivotal moment for him was breaking Auger-Aliassime’s serve at 3-2 in the first set, which significantly boosted his confidence.

However, Atmane also acknowledged the challenges faced in the second set. “Félix was better than me in every department,” he admitted, indicating a period where he struggled to gain traction. He also alluded to having “similar feelings to Cincinnati,” hinting at past experiences, but cautiously added, “that doesn’t mean I’ll replicate…” implying a careful approach to future expectations and results.
